What Are DeFAI Tokens and Why Do They Matter?
DeFAI tokens are AI-enhanced digital assets that reside on blockchain networks and possess embedded intelligence. Unlike traditional DeFi tokens that follow predetermined logic, DeFAI tokens can ingest data, interpret it, and take contextual actions through learning algorithms. These tokens operate autonomously, often communicating with decentralized applications (dApps), smart contracts, and off-chain systems through APIs and oracles.
They are capable of managing complex workflows, making probabilistic decisions, and continuously optimizing processes based on feedback. For businesses, this means the ability to reduce human oversight, minimize delays, and eliminate redundant steps in critical operations. The automation that DeFAI enables is not just rule-based—it’s adaptive, context-aware, and self-improving.
By decentralizing intelligence and embedding it into tokens, businesses are empowered to build leaner, more resilient, and scalable operations that are secure, transparent, and cost-efficient.
Financial Management and Treasury Optimization
One of the most direct areas where DeFAI tokens reduce operational costs is financial management. Traditional treasury functions such as payments, invoicing, cash flow monitoring, and reconciliation require human teams and legacy software to operate efficiently. These systems are prone to errors, delays, and high administrative overhead.
DeFAI tokens can automate treasury management end-to-end. For example, intelligent tokens can schedule payments based on invoice maturity, adjust liquidity positions across wallets, and forecast cash requirements using predictive analytics. They can detect duplicate invoices, categorize expenses, and even trigger asset swaps based on currency fluctuations—saving time and reducing the need for financial intermediaries.
In decentralized organizations or DAO-based structures, DeFAI tokens can handle contributor payouts, monitor budgets, and allocate funds to projects based on predefined goals and performance metrics. This level of automation not only cuts costs but improves financial agility and responsiveness in real time.
Supply Chain Optimization and Logistics Efficiency
Managing supply chains involves multiple stakeholders, documentation, asset tracking, and time-sensitive coordination across borders. Businesses often face high costs due to delays, inefficiencies, and miscommunication. DeFAI tokens are transforming this process by introducing real-time intelligence and automation into every stage of the supply chain.
With the help of IoT integrations and AI models, DeFAI tokens can track shipments, monitor conditions like temperature or humidity, and initiate smart contracts when delivery milestones are met. This reduces reliance on manual verification and paperwork. For example, a token can automatically trigger a payment to a supplier once goods are verified as delivered and in acceptable condition.
Furthermore, DeFAI tokens can forecast inventory levels, suggest optimal shipping routes, and adjust logistics strategies in real-time based on demand data and supplier behavior. This level of automation minimizes stockouts, reduces waste, and eliminates unnecessary storage costs. In industries such as manufacturing, agriculture, and retail, the ability to run autonomous supply chains significantly reduces operational expenditure.

Intelligent Compliance and Regulatory Automation
For businesses operating in regulated industries such as finance, healthcare, or real estate, compliance is a major cost center. It involves reporting, documentation, audits, and ongoing monitoring—all of which require trained staff and expensive legal resources. DeFAI tokens offer a path toward intelligent compliance that reduces manual workload and ensures regulatory consistency.
Tokens embedded with compliance logic can track user transactions, flag suspicious behavior, and generate audit-ready reports in real time. They can analyze jurisdictional requirements and automatically adjust operational parameters based on local laws—such as data storage regulations or financial thresholds.
For example, in a decentralized lending platform, DeFAI tokens can ensure KYC/AML procedures are followed by checking user credentials and transaction history using federated identity systems and external data sources. This eliminates the need for large compliance teams while improving accuracy and reducing penalties due to oversight.
Automating these tasks with AI-powered tokens reduces costs not only in compliance but also in legal consulting, training, and internal audits—making operations more secure and cost-effective.

Challenges and Strategic Considerations
Despite the advantages, adopting DeFAI tokens requires careful planning. AI models embedded within tokens must be trained on relevant and unbiased data. Model explainability is important to maintain trust, especially in high-stakes decisions like financial risk or employee evaluations.
Infrastructure is another challenge. While many businesses are still adjusting to basic Web3 integrations, DeFAI requires robust connectivity to decentralized data sources, secure AI compute infrastructure, and smart contract platforms. Businesses must also consider privacy, security, and regulatory frameworks when using AI in decentralized environments.
Employee reskilling is also a necessary step. As DeFAI tokens take over operational roles, companies must prepare their workforce to manage, audit, and interact with these intelligent systems effectively. Additionally, strong governance structures are needed to ensure that token-based automation aligns with business objectives and values.
